NOTICE: is no longer in use from 1st March 2024. Please use the OpenStreetMap Community Forum


I am using OpenLayers library for embedding maps into a commercial browser application. I am using OSM as tile server ( ) with OpenLayers API. The embedded map contains some markers with tooltips. I want to embed OSM map () into a commercial browser application. Open Layers has BSD 2 licence and using the OSM tiles ( ) are under the CC-BY-SA license.

Below are my queries:

  1. Can I use OSM via OpenLayers in commercial application ? If yes, what should be the licence of the commercial product ?
  2. Should I display the credits "© OpenStreetMap contributors" in the embedded map ?

Thank you !

asked 16 Jan '20, 19:11

ui-ninja-cj's gravatar image

accept rate: 0%

  1. You may if you adhere to the Tiles Usage policy and the the attribution guildelines as seen in 2. Be aware that OSM is not a tile service and your application may get blocked without any given reason. So this may not be the best business decision.

  2. See: - you not only should but you have to attribute OpenStreeMap contributors.

permanent link

answered 16 Jan '20, 21:04

Spiekerooger's gravatar image

accept rate: 16%

edited 16 Jan '20, 21:07

Follow this question

By Email:

Once you sign in you will be able to subscribe for any updates here



Answers and Comments

Markdown Basics

  • *italic* or _italic_
  • **bold** or __bold__
  • link:[text]( "title")
  • image?![alt text](/path/img.jpg "title")
  • numbered list: 1. Foo 2. Bar
  • to add a line break simply add two spaces to where you would like the new line to be.
  • basic HTML tags are also supported

Question tags:


question asked: 16 Jan '20, 19:11

question was seen: 2,749 times

last updated: 16 Jan '20, 21:07

NOTICE: is no longer in use from 1st March 2024. Please use the OpenStreetMap Community Forum